utrophin; dystrophin-related protein 1; DRP1; DRP (UTRN, DMDL)

Function: - may play a role in anchoring the cytoskeleton to the plasma membrane - interacts with the syntrophins SNTA1; SNTB1 & SNTB2 - interacts with SYNM - may act as a functional endogenous replacement for dystrophin [3] Structure: - contains 2 CH (calponin-homology) domains - contains 20 spectrin repeats - contains 1 WW domain - contains 1 ZZ-type Zn+2 finger Compartment: - cell junction, synapse, postsynaptic cell membrane - peripheral membrane protein; cytoplasmic side - cytoplasm, cytoskeleton - neuromuscular junction Expression: muscle Pharmacology: - ezutromid, a utrophin modulator, is an investigative agent for treatment of children with Duchenne muscular dystrophy [3]

Properties

SIZE: entity length = 3433 aa MW = 394 kD COMPARTMENT: cytoplasm MOTIF: actin-binding site SITE: 1-246 FOR-BINDING-OF: F-actin MOTIF: Tyr phosphorylation site {Y4} Ser phosphorylation site {S10} calponin homology domain NAME: calponin homology domain SITE: 31-135 calponin homology domain NAME: calponin homology domain SITE: 150-252 spectrin repeat {253-308} SYNM interaction {268-905} MOTIF: Ser phosphorylation site {S295} spectrin repeat {309-417} spectrin repeat {418-526} spectrin repeat {541-637} spectrin repeat {687-798} spectrin repeat {803-902} spectrin repeat {1016-1083} spectrin repeat {1125-1230} spectrin repeat {1248-1334} MOTIF: Thr phosphorylation site {T1266} SYNM interaction {1336-1768} MOTIF: spectrin repeat {1432-1541} spectrin repeat {1544-1649} spectrin repeat {1652-1753} spectrin repeat {1910-1968} spectrin repeat {1976-2081} spectrin repeat {2258-2333} spectrin repeat {2399-2440} spectrin repeat {2443-2556} spectrin repeat {2559-2636} spectrin repeat {2658-2688} spectrin repeat {2691-2797} SYNM interaction {2798-3165} MOTIF: WW domain (W/rsp5/WWP domain) {2812-2845} Zn finger ZZ-type NAME: Zn finger ZZ-type SITE: 3064-3111 EFFECTOR-BOUND: Zn+2 Ser phosphorylation site {S3180} Ser phosphorylation site {S3182} Ser phosphorylation site {S3297} Ser phosphorylation site {S3304}
